Choosing the Right Timco Bright Zinc Nails

Selecting the right nail size and type is crucial for ensuring a secure and lasting fix.

1. Nail Length

Choose a length that provides at least 2.5 times the thickness of the material being nailed. This ensures a firm grip and stability.

2. Corrosion Resistance

Opt for zinc-coated nails when working in environments exposed to moisture, as they resist rust and prolong the life of your project.

Timco Bright Zinc Nails FAQs

Are these nails suitable for outdoor use?

Yes, the zinc coating provides a level of corrosion resistance, making them suitable for exterior applications where moisture exposure is a factor.

Can these nails be used with nail guns?

No, these are loose nails designed for manual hammer use. For nail guns, opt for collated nails or strips.

How do I choose the right nail size for my project?

Consider the thickness of the material you're joining. A general rule is that the nail should be at least 2.5 times the thickness of the timber being fixed.
